Precautions for the operation of paper stiffness meter

Paper stiffness is an important indicator of paper and board materials. Stiffness directly affects the bending properties of paper ( stiffness is also called bending stiffness ). Our paper mills generally need to be equipped with a set of paper stiffness Testers for follow-up testing. However, the maintenance and after-use maintenance of the paper stiffness Tester often have a certain impact on the accuracy of the measurement data.

Precautions

1. The stiffness chuck should not clamp other samples before starting to use, so as not to affect the reset accuracy and crush the sensor.

2. Please warm up for 10 minutes before testing every day; it is strongly recommended to ground the protective ground wire; once the product data shows abnormality, please turn off the power immediately. It takes more than 10 minutes between turning off the power switch and turning it on again.

3. When selecting the sample, the surface of the sample should be free from defects such as wrinkles, wrinkles, and visible damage.

4. Cut the sample with a special stiffness sampler.

5. Mechanical zero adjustment: select a sample as the zero adjustment sample, gently turn the handle of the fixture with one hand, and put a section of the sample to be tested into the fixture with the other hand. Adjust the fine-tuning screw on the sensor end until the sample is close to the sensor measuring head to complete the mechanical calibration.

6. Do not touch the sensor.

maintenance method

1. When not in use for a long time, keep the testing machine clean and add a dust cover.

2. If the testing machine breaks down, professionals should be invited to check and eliminate it. Do not operate in a faulty condition.

3. The transmission screw of the testing machine should be filled with a small amount of lubricating oil from time to time.

4. Adhere to regular verification to keep the testing machine in good technical condition. The verification period is generally one year.
